From morning until evening, Geraldine pretends to be a young royal who goes through each day doing the same as a princess, even though others may not believe in her. This is a beautiful children's story that will warm everyone's heart. Anyone can believe in something if they really feel it in their heart.
( ) The very Fairy Princess is about a girl who believes that she is a princess. Everyday she goes through her princess routine of putting on her crown dressing to perfection and eating very well. Throughout her day her moto is to "sparkle", she loves to sparkle and wants everyone else to as well. She always has a top notch attitue and loves to be loved. This book is a great book to read when learning the concept of believing in yourself and be who you want to be. In the very fairy princess story the young girl believed that she was a true princess. Be who you want to be and do it to the fullest. Summary from Goodreads.com Everyone's favorite fairy princess is back and just in time for her ballet recital in this new picture book addition to the Julie Andrews Collection. At first, when Gerry is cast as the Court Jester and not the Crystal Princess, she is dismayed -- nothing is pink and no one can see her crown under her silly jester hat! But just as the recital looks like it's headed for disaster, our ever-energetic very fairy princess swoops in to save the day! Gerry's sparkle radiates from the page once more through Christine Davenier's whimsically elegant illustrations in this spirited, ballet-themed follow-up to The Very Fairy Princess from the renowned mother-daughter team of Julie Andrews and Emma Walton Hamilton. What I liked about the book: The illustrations are colorful and will appeal to young readers. I like that the story provides a message about what it means to be a good sport and team member without coming on too strong. Gerry is a good role model for young girls. She's not perfect, but she tries hard. It will be easy for readers to identify with her. Young girls who like princesses, fairies and the color pink will enjoy this book.
